    • PROBLEM TO BE SOLVED: To provide a charging device for a premise telephone set for accurately performing charging on a time of use of the telephone even in a telephone line of an optical fiber where polarity inversion does not occur.
      SOLUTION: The present invention relates to a charging device for a premise telephone set in which, together with a signal tone detection means for detecting a signal tone from a telephone line connected to the premise telephone set, a hook connection detection means is provided for detecting connection and disconnection states of a line using a hook of the premise telephone set. A ring back tone of the premise telephone is detected by the signal tone detection means and on a condition where the ring back tone is stopped and the hook connection detection means detects that the hook is up and connected to the line, connection to a partner is determined to start charging. When stopping charging, a disconnection signal tone of the partner is detected by the signal tone detection means or it is detected by the hook connection detection means that the hook is down and the line is cut off, and charging is stopped.

    • PURPOSE: To bring a water sprinkling state and the remote and near distance of sprinkled water to a desired mode, by loosening or tightening the screw thread of a nozzle cap engaged with the screw provided to the tip of a cylinder when water is discharged.
      CONSTITUTION: When a water stream W is introduced into a nozzle main body through a hose, it goes straight on through the main passage 1 of a water discharge cylinder A. When a cap B is loosen, divided streams W
      1 , W
      1 are discharged from branched water passages 1', 1' and met while engaged with the total peripheries of a contact element 2 and a member 2', a wall 9 and the thin wall of the water sprinkling orifice of the cap B. At this time, a desired water stream mode is generated corresponding to the loosening degree or the tightening degree of the cap B. For example, when the loosening of the cap B is set to about 270°, a mist stream flies horizontally to reach about 3.3m in a forward direction. When set to 360°, the water stream comes to a thick bundled strip form to reach about 4.2m. In addition, in the 180°-loosening, an expansion angle of about 110° is obtained.

    • There is provided a cooling device not affected by gravity by exerting a strong capillary attraction to be hard to deteriorate in transportation function. Unidirectionally-aligned copper fiber assembly 8 is mounted, by a sintering process, on an inner wall of a heat pipe 3 along the longitudinal direction of the heat pipe 3. Therefore, by a strong capillary attraction caused by fine copper fiber assembly 8, purified water can be transported without being affected by gravity. A flow volume just enough for the purified water to be prevented from drying out by its evaporation can be maintained, thus making it hard for a function in the transportation of the purified water to be deactivated. Further, the unidirectionally-aligned copper fiber assembly 8 is mounted along the longitudinal direction of heat pipe 3 and hence the purified water smoothly flows in the longitudinal direction of heat pipe 3.
